WORKING in different contexts is proving a challenging - and stimulating - way of developing collaborative leadership skills sets.

Scottish Leadership Foundation's innovative People Exchange programme - which includes attachments and secondments, shadowing and twinning, mentoring and organisational raids/enquiry visits - is encouraging movement across different sectors. It is providing opportunities for senior managers and public service leaders to develop new areas of skills or expertise, and to share their skills, experience and practice.
